Summary
AllPoints Fibre
isp legacy
The national network of AllPoints Fibre, a UK full-fibre "altnet" wholesaler
and broadband operator headquartered in Reading.
What it's used for
- Full-fibre broadband access for homes and businesses across the UK, plus the wholesale platform AllPoints resells to retail ISP partners.
- Subscriber address space: reverse DNS on the IPv4 ranges resolves under
cgn.as5482.net, indicating carrier-grade NAT pools for broadband customers.
Notable
- AllPoints Fibre was assembled by consolidating several regional UK altnets, and AS5482 is the single network the group converged on. Legacy naming survives in reverse DNS: some ranges still resolve under
giga.net.ukfrom the Giganet network folded into the group. - Registry remarks list transit from Arelion and Zayo and peering at LONAP and LINX, alongside direct sessions with the large content and cloud networks - a conventional eyeball-network peering posture.
Interesting
- The AS number is far lower than the company, which is recent. AllPoints operates under this number today; it is not evidence of an early-internet pedigree for the present holder.
